They are only closing underperforming locations like Memphis. In some markets they are opening new full sized stores, small format stores and plan & order points.

Small format stores are around 35-75,000 sq ft with a curated collection of items. Plan & Order are for kitchen, bath and bedroom planning but offer order pickup from the locations.

I think Dallas and Phoenix will have all 3 types of stores this year.

I have a TBR (Eero 6). As noted in the post, I have other Ikea devices connected over Matter/Thread to Alexa and devices from other brands. This issue is only occurring when trying to connect the Klippbok to Alexa.

I bought many Klippbok water sensors and tried to connect them all. Hoping it was a one off issue. None will connect to Alexa.

As of this message I haven't found anyone with Klippbok connected to Alexa. I know Alexa isn't the best platform, but it is the largest in the US. Shocking that Ikea wouldn't test these with the largest platforms before claiming compatibility on the product page.

I once had the mindset to sparingly use nice things so they last longer. We had nice china, the good wine glasses, the nice silverware, nice clothes. I realized this was not rational as I was donating old clothes in perfect condition because they didn't fit or were out of style. I wore them a few times but could have gotten so much more enjoyment out of them. Why were we arbitrarily limiting our enjoyment only to run out of time when the items become out of style or fit.

We now wear the good clothes, eat off the china and use the good silverware. The everyday items were donated and we have less things that are used more often. Life feels lighter, we are enjoying our things and we spend less because we only need the one set instead of a good item and an everyday item.

By the time we need something new its also a good time to update to current styles.
